No Surprises Here

Surprising absolutely no one, NYC Mayor and mayoral candidate Mike Bloomberg sent out a mailing (approximately the ten thousandth I've received) hitting newly nominated mayoral candidate Bill Thompson over their compared education records. I got the flyer in my mail on Wednesday, which is pretty impressive when you consider that Thompson didn't win the primary until late Tuesday night. Maybe the mail will run better if Bloomberg is re-re-elected.

The flyer doesn't go in much for subtlety. On the top in huge red letters it says "On Education: The Choice Is Clear." Then there's a T-chart showing Mike Bloomberg's record as mayor compared to Bill Thompson's record as president of the board of education. Unsurprisingly (this is campaign lit after all), Bloomberg looks very good in the comparison. I wish I could show it to you, but I don't have a scanner. I'm sure if you check your mail boxes, you'll be seeing it soon. Even if you don't live in New York.

Not much to say here, but I do have three quick observations.

1. It's nice to see education featured so prominently in a political campaign.
2. It's a shame that the issue is being used as a bludgeon instead of a launch point for real discussion.
3. When one side has billions of dollars to spend on advertising it's not really a surprise that we aren't going to have a nuanced conversation.
